LOS ANGELES (GaeaTimes.com)- The latest legal drama to hit American TV screens this fall is ‘The Whole Truth‘ and it promises some great drama in the season ahead. The pilot episode was aired on Wednesday and fans all over have been scrambling the web ever since to get more details on the Jerry Bruckheimer production. The episodic nature of the show will allow audiences to catch up at any time in the season. Many have called it a new style of legal with the cases being showcased from both sides and thus providing ‘The Whole Truth’.

‘The Whole Truth‘ stars Maura Tierney and Rob Morrow who play two hot shot attorneys who compete against each other. The strong supporting cast, that includes Sean Wing and Eamonn Walker, also gives the show the necessary depth. The structure of the show is unique as well as the cases finally reach their climax during the battle in court. Before the court and the jury’s decision, the case is seen being researched separately by the prosecution as well as the defense. Whether the suspect is guilty or innocent is only revealed after the jury has made the decision.

In the pilot episode of ‘The Whole Truth‘, a murder suspect was found guilty by the jury. In spite of a contrary build up it was revealed that the suspect was guilty after all. Interestingly, the series explores some loopholes in the legal structure that makes everything finally boil down to the decision of the jury. The point that the show makes is that justice might depend on the act that a lawyer puts up in front of the jury. Fans are now looking forward to the case where the guilty will be acquitted and the innocent convicted.
